    I don't think adding ball recovery's is too complicated, imo the current BPS system is too complicated and convoluted, I'd wager that only a tiny % of the player base knows how they are tallied up, the Sky system with tackles or the Uefa system with recovery's is much easier to understand imo

    If they keep the current BPS system then I'd personally like to see players from both teams in a match get bonus points regardless of the result, as I'm sure there would be quite a few hidden gem bonus magnets from crap teams that you wouldn't normally consider that would help expand the viable player pool

    It probably won't be any of the above though, but I do think last season's challenge FPL was possibly a trial run of being able to change your team throughout the gw, maybe not transfers after the deadline but certainly being able to change captain before he plays or make manual subs if one of your players doesn't start etc could be possible

      I still play the Sky game but don't give it as much attention as FPL. No bench but you can make transfers and change captains each day during a GW. Always funny when missing a deadline (or running out of transfers, maximum of 5 per GW and no hits) benefits you and it happens more than you'd expect, but would probably mean regular minor annoyances if FPL introduced something similar.
